Elevateat a Glance
What it is
Elevate is more than a program—it’s our safety culture and mindset. It’s a third-party accredited framework that drives continuous improvement, accountability, and proactive risk management. Elevate sets the standard across all projects and reflects our commitment to raising the bar every day in how we lead, work, and protect our teams.
How it works
Built on industry-leading practices and aligned with ANSI Z10 Safety Management System standards, Elevate addresses all key elements of effective safety and risk management. The program integrates proactive processes, targeted training, and automated smart risk assessment tools that streamline safety and drive excellence at every level.
Proof it delivers
Sevan was honored in 2024 as a National Safety Excellence Award winner by Associated Builders and Contractors—a recognition that reflects our long-standing commitment to safety. This commitment is also evident in our performance metrics: our EMR has remained below 1.0 since the company's inception, and our injury rate is 84% lower than the national average.
